The Spanish Structural Concrete Code (EHE, in Spanish) includes, in its Appendix 13, a model for assessing structural sustainability. This model is based in the MIVES method (Integrated Value-based Model for Sustainability Assessment, in Spanish), and includes the evaluation of different environmental, social and economic indicators, related to the structure design and construction.According to the EHE, when a sustainable structure is designed, it is necessary to estimate the EHE sustainability index at least two times: after finishing the design and when the construction has been completed. On the other hand, performing additional estimations in other moments of the project life-cycle is inevitable. During the design stages this will serve to make decisions in order to obtain a design matching the sustainability objective established by the client. The subsequent assessments performed during the procurement and construction stages will serve for monitoring and controlling purposes; this will allow increasing the likelihood of achieving the referred to objective. Despite the corresponding calculations are not excessively complex, they are long and a little tedious. So it is necessary to have a tool to save time and streamline the estimating process, facilitating and speeding up the decision-making process. This article presents a free of charge computer tool for this purpose, in order to encourage the design of sustainable structures. On the other hand, the paper also summarizes the foundations of the EHE sustainability assessment model, to clarify the method and the calculations to be performed.
